Précédent   Forum des professionnels en informatique > Bases de données > Oracle
Oracle Forum Oracle : le serveur, les outils, ... Voir F.A.Q Oracle Tutoriels Oracle
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 21/04/2011, 16h24   #1
Invité régulier
 
Inscription : avril 2009
Messages : 28
Détails du profil
Informations forums :
Inscription : avril 2009
Messages : 28
Points : 6
Points : 6
Par défaut problème dans une requête

Bonjour,

Voilà j'ai un problème au niveau d'exécution dans une requête.

j'ai deux tables A (id , nom) et B (id, date)

---------
A
---------
ID | NOM
--------
1 | toto1
2 | toto2
3 | toto3
---------

---------------------
B
---------------------
ID | ID(A) | DATE
---------------------
1 | 1 | 01/03/2010
2 | 2 | 20/03/2009
3 | 1 | 15/02/2011
4 | 3 | 22/01/2008
5 | 3 | 05/06/2009
6 | 3 | 17/09/2010
7 | 1 | 05/02/2008

Je veux afficher chaque utilisateur avec son dernier date !!!

Merci pour votre aide
DELAYMEN1 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 21/04/2011, 16h55   #2
Membre Expert
 
Femme
Ingénieur développement logiciels
Inscription : juin 2007
Messages : 480
Détails du profil
Informations personnelles :
Sexe : Femme
Localisation : France, Ain (Rhône Alpes)

Informations professionnelles :
Activité : Ingénieur développement logiciels

Informations forums :
Inscription : juin 2007
Messages : 480
Points : 1 024
Points : 1 024
Bonjour,
J'ai renommé les champs ID(A) en ID_A et DATE en DATE_B, sinon cela donne des erreurs de syntaxe :
Code :
1
2
3
SELECT A.NOM Utilisateur, Max_D Derniere_date
FROM (SELECT B.ID_A, MAX(DATE_B) Max_D FROM B GROUP BY ID_A) X
JOIN A ON A.ID=X.ID_A
tedo01 est déconnecté   Envoyer un message privé Réponse avec citation 20
Vieux 21/04/2011, 17h18   #3
Invité régulier
 
Inscription : avril 2009
Messages : 28
Détails du profil
Informations forums :
Inscription : avril 2009
Messages : 28
Points : 6
Points : 6
Merci infiniment
DELAYMEN1 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 21/04/2011, 18h00   #4
Modérateur
 
Homme Fabien
Ingénieur d'études en décisionnel
Inscription : septembre 2008
Messages : 5 684
Détails du profil
Informations personnelles :
Nom : Homme Fabien
Âge : 34
Localisation : France, Yvelines (Île de France)

Informations professionnelles :
Activité : Ingénieur d'études en décisionnel
Secteur : Arts - Culture

Informations forums :
Inscription : septembre 2008
Messages : 5 684
Points : 10 438
Points : 10 438
Envoyer un message via ICQ à Waldar Envoyer un message via Skype™ à Waldar
Attention à votre besoin, ici ne ressortiront que les utilisateurs qui ont au moins une date.
Si vous les voulez tous, il faudra effectuer une jointure externe.
__________________
Email : http://scr.im/waldar
Waldar est actuellement connecté   Envoyer un message privé Réponse avec citation 10
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 12h27.


 
 
 
 
Partenaires

Hébergement Web